Timezone in Mungkid
Mungkid, located in Central Java, Indonesia, operates under the Asia/Jakarta timezone, which has a UTC offset of +7 hours. This means that Mungkid is seven hours ahead of Coordinated Universal Time. Indonesia does not observe daylight saving time, maintaining this offset year-round without any changes, making it straightforward for scheduling and planning.
When considering time differences with the United States, Mungkid can be significantly ahead, with major cities like New York being 12 hours behind, while Los Angeles is 14 hours behind. This means that if it is noon in Mungkid, it is midnight in New York and 10 PM the previous day in Los Angeles. The best time to contact someone in Mungkid would be during their business hours, ideally between 8 AM and 5 PM, which aligns with late evening in the United States, making it a challenge for real-time communication.
In comparison with other major cities in the region, Mungkid shares the same UTC offset with cities like Jakarta and Bandung. However, cities in neighboring countries, such as Kuala Lumpur and Singapore, are one hour ahead due to their UTC+8 offset. Attractions and Activities in Mungkid
Mungkid is a sub-district in Magelang Regency, located in Central Java, Indonesia. It is known for its proximity to the iconic Borobudur Temple, a UNESCO World Heritage site and the worldβs largest Buddhist monument. The temple attracts numerous visitors, and its stunning architecture and intricate reliefs make it a significant cultural and historical highlight of the region.
In addition to Borobudur, Mungkid is characterized by its lush agricultural landscape, with rice paddies and traditional farming practices prevalent in the area. The region is also known for its cool, mountainous climate, making it a pleasant escape from the heat found in lower areas of Java. Local culture is enriched by various traditions and festivals, reflecting the vibrant Javanese heritage, including traditional music and dance performances.
The annual Borobudur International Festival, which showcases cultural performances, is a notable event that highlights the region’s commitment to preserving its cultural heritage while promoting tourism.
Practical Information for Visitors
Mungkid is accessible through various transport options. The nearest airport is Adisucipto International Airport in Yogyakarta, approximately 45 kilometers away. From the airport, visitors can take a taxi or arrange for a car rental.
Mungkid is also reachable by train, with the closest train station being in Yogyakarta, offering connections to several major cities. Additionally, buses operate between Mungkid and other nearby towns, providing a budget-friendly option for travelers. The climate in Mungkid is tropical, with warm temperatures year-round.
The wet season typically runs from November to March, while the dry season spans from April to October. The best time to visit Mungkid is during the dry season, especially from May to September, when outdoor activities are more enjoyable and the weather is generally sunny. For visitors, it’s recommended to dress in lightweight, breathable clothing due to the warm climate.
